Transaction 258a25ffffe455eaa36a9e66f40148aef9d433ab3d5576fc9230d35c79d71c3a

2 Input
1 Outputs
  • 258a25ffffe455eaa36a9e66f40148aef9d433ab3d5576fc9230d35c79d71c3a:0
  • value  3708080
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G